JPY/BRL in 2006: key facts

In 2006, 1 Japanese Yen was worth 0.018727 BRL on average. The pair opened 2006 at 0.019817 and closed at 0.017932 — a change of −9.51%. The 2006 high was 0.021291 BRL and the low was 0.017745 BRL, based on 255 trading days of European Central Bank euro foreign exchange reference rates.

January had 2006’s highest monthly average at 0.019690 BRL per JPY; October had the lowest, at 0.018115 BRL.
